Hello, what bank do you recommend for accepting payments with a high exchange rate and fast, hassle-free remittance? Thank you!

Hi @Giselle216 !
Airbnb payouts are already converted to pesos at the time of processing, so we don’t have the option to choose a payout method that offers a higher exchange rate.
Personally, I prefer receiving payouts directly to my bank either UnionBank, BDO, or PSBank. The funds usually arrive within 2-3 days after check-in, and so far, I’ve never had any issues.
If you’re looking for a fast and hassle-free option, I’d recommend choosing any local bank. Hope this helps! 😊
